Empowering Organizations: The Role of Computer and Information Systems Managers

Computer and Information Systems Managers

The Role of Computer and Information Systems Managers

Computer and information systems managers, also known as IT managers or IT project managers, play a crucial role in organizations by overseeing the implementation of technology solutions to meet business objectives. These professionals are responsible for planning, coordinating, and directing all computer-related activities within an organization.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Strategic Planning: Computer and information systems managers develop strategic plans for the use of technology in an organization to achieve its goals.
  • Implementation: They oversee the implementation of new systems, software, and hardware to improve efficiency and productivity.
  • Security: Ensuring data security and protecting against cyber threats is a critical aspect of their role.
  • Budgeting: IT managers are often responsible for managing the IT budget and ensuring cost-effective use of resources.
  • Team Management: They lead teams of IT professionals, providing guidance and support to ensure projects are completed successfully.

Educational Requirements:

Most computer and information systems managers hold a bachelor’s degree in computer science, information technology, or a related field. Some positions may require a master’s degree or MBA with a focus on technology management.

Career Outlook:

The demand for computer and information systems managers is expected to grow as organizations increasingly rely on technology to drive their operations. Job opportunities exist in various industries, including healthcare, finance, government, and more.

What is the highest salary for computer and information systems managers?

The highest salary for computer and information systems managers can vary depending on factors such as the level of experience, location, industry, and size of the organization.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, as of May 2020, the median annual wage for computer and information systems managers was $151,150. However, top earners in this field can earn significantly more, with salaries exceeding $208,000 per year in some cases. Industries such as information services and finance tend to offer higher salaries for experienced IT managers with a track record of success in implementing technology solutions that drive business growth and innovation.

Optimize meta tags including title tags and meta descriptions.

To enhance your website’s organic search engine optimization, it is crucial to optimize meta tags, including title tags and meta descriptions. Title tags provide a concise and descriptive title for each webpage, influencing how it appears in search results and affecting click-through rates. Meta descriptions, on the other hand, offer a brief summary of the page’s content, enticing users to click on your link. By optimizing these meta tags with relevant keywords and compelling information, you can improve your site’s visibility in search engine results pages and attract more organic traffic to your website.

How does PPC advertising work in SEM?

PPC advertising, a key component of Search Engine Marketing (SEM), works by allowing businesses to bid on specific keywords relevant to their target audience. When users search for these keywords on search engines like Google, ads related to those keywords may appear at the top or bottom of the search results page. Advertisers pay a fee each time someone clicks on their ad, hence the term “pay-per-click.” The position of the ad is determined by a combination of bid amount and ad relevance. PPC advertising in SEM provides businesses with a highly targeted way to reach potential customers, drive traffic to their websites, and ultimately achieve their marketing objectives.

How can businesses measure the success of their SEM campaigns?

Businesses can measure the success of their SEM campaigns through various key performance indicators (KPIs) that provide valuable insights into the effectiveness of their marketing efforts. Metrics such as click-through rate (CTR), conversion rate, cost per click (CPC), return on ad spend (ROAS), and overall return on investment (ROI) are commonly used to evaluate the performance of SEM campaigns. By tracking these metrics and analyzing campaign data, businesses can assess factors like ad relevance, audience targeting, keyword performance, and overall campaign profitability. Utilizing analytics tools and setting clear campaign objectives are essential steps in measuring and optimizing the success of SEM campaigns to achieve desired outcomes and maximize results.

The Difference Between SEO and SEM

The Difference Between SEO and SEM

Search Engine Optimization (SEO) and Search Engine Marketing (SEM) are two essential strategies for improving a website’s visibility in search engine results. While they both aim to increase traffic to a website, they involve different tactics and approaches.

SEO: Search Engine Optimization

SEO focuses on optimizing a website’s content, structure, and other elements to improve its organic (unpaid) search engine rankings. This involves keyword research, on-page optimization, link building, and technical improvements to make the site more search engine-friendly. The goal of SEO is to attract organic traffic from search engines like Google, Yahoo, and Bing.

SEM: Search Engine Marketing

SEM encompasses paid advertising efforts to promote a website on search engine results pages (SERPs). This includes pay-per-click (PPC) advertising campaigns through platforms like Google Ads or Bing Ads. SEM allows businesses to target specific keywords and audiences through paid ads that appear at the top of search results.

Key Differences

  • Nature: SEO is focused on organic strategies, while SEM involves paid advertising.
  • Timeline: SEO is a long-term strategy that requires ongoing efforts for sustainable results, while SEM can provide immediate visibility but stops when the ad budget runs out.
  • Cost: SEO is generally more cost-effective in the long run as it doesn’t require payment per click or impression like SEM.
  • Visibility: While both strategies aim to increase visibility in search results, SEM ads are prominently displayed at the top of SERPs, giving immediate exposure.
